原神是用的什么编程语言
-
原神是一款由中国游戏公司miHoYo开发的开放世界角色扮演游戏。根据miHoYo官方的信息,原神是使用C++语言开发的。
C++是一种通用编程语言,广泛应用于游戏开发领域。它的特点是高性能、灵活性和可移植性,这使得C++成为开发大型游戏项目的理想选择。C++具有直接访问硬件的能力,并且可以提供高效的内存管理和资源控制,这对于游戏的流畅性和稳定性非常重要。
在原神的开发过程中,C++语言被用于实现游戏的核心功能,包括游戏引擎、图形渲染、物理模拟、网络通信等方面。此外,原神还使用了其他编程语言和技术,比如Lua脚本语言用于游戏逻辑的编写,以及OpenGL和DirectX等图形接口用于图形渲染。
总的来说,原神使用了C++语言作为主要的开发语言,这也是很多大型游戏开发公司常用的选择。C++的强大功能和高效性使得原神能够在各种平台上实现卓越的性能和用户体验。
1年前 -
原神是一款由中国游戏开发公司miHoYo开发的开放世界动作角色扮演游戏。根据公开信息,原神使用了以下编程语言:
-
C++:原神的底层引擎和核心功能是使用C++编写的。C++是一种高性能的编程语言,常用于游戏开发,能够提供更好的性能和更高的控制能力。
-
Lua:Lua是一种轻量级的脚本语言,也是原神中使用的一种重要的编程语言。Lua在游戏开发中被广泛使用,它可以用于实现游戏逻辑、AI、界面交互等功能。
-
Python:Python是一种高级的、通用的编程语言,也是原神中使用的一种编程语言。Python主要用于开发工具和辅助功能,如自动化测试、数据分析等。
-
OpenGL:OpenGL是一种跨平台的图形库,用于实现原神中的图形渲染和绘制。OpenGL可以提供高性能的图形处理能力,使得游戏在不同平台上都能够流畅运行。
-
JavaScript:JavaScript是一种常用的脚本语言,也是原神中使用的一种编程语言。JavaScript主要用于实现游戏的用户界面和交互效果。
综上所述,原神使用了C++、Lua、Python、OpenGL和JavaScript等多种编程语言来实现不同的功能,从而创建了这款精美的开放世界游戏。
1年前 -
-
原神是一款由中国游戏公司miHoYo开发的开放世界动作角色扮演游戏。根据官方公开的信息,原神使用了C++编程语言来开发游戏。
C++是一种通用的高级编程语言,它继承了C语言的特性,并在此基础上增加了面向对象编程的能力。C++具有高性能、可移植性和灵活性等特点,因此在游戏开发中被广泛应用。
在原神的开发过程中,开发团队使用C++语言来实现游戏的核心功能,如游戏引擎、物理引擎、图形渲染、人物控制等。C++的强大性能和灵活性使得开发团队能够更好地控制游戏的性能和资源利用,从而实现更好的游戏体验。
此外,原神还使用了其他编程语言和技术来支持游戏的开发。例如,游戏的前端界面可能使用了HTML、CSS和JavaScript等技术来实现;网络通信可能使用了TCP/IP和HTTP协议来实现与服务器的通信;音效和音乐可能使用了特定的音频编程库来实现。
总之,原神使用了C++作为主要的编程语言来开发游戏,并结合其他技术和语言来完善游戏的各个方面。这种选择能够为玩家带来流畅、稳定和具有高度可玩性的游戏体验。
1年前